As “going green” becomes more prevalent in today’s eco-conscious world, businesses are climbing on board. The Las Vegas Green Chamber of Commerce is a fairly new organization that encourages businesses to band together to encourage others to take the plunge into global environmental awareness.

Launched in August of 2010, the Las Vegas Green Chamber of Commerce is about to celebrate their one year anniversary. Their vision of a future where Las Vegas businesses will help to protect our planet is growing stronger with time.

Las Vegas Eco-Friendly Businesses

Eco-friendly businesses in Las Vegas may join this growing group that strives to raise the public’s awareness of and promote green policies and practices. Monthly networking opportunities help provide an avenue for learning more, as well as meeting others that have implemented green practices.

Las Vegas Green Chamber of Commerce Board Members

Some prominent Las Vegas executives are active board members to help promote the Las Vegas chapter of the Green Chamber of Commerce:

  • Gregory St. Martin, President
  • Michael Woodfield (Bank of Nevada), Vice-President
  • Terry Bryant (Freeman), Secretary
  • Valerie Parker (VP Marketing), Board Member
  • Monica Brett (Southwest Energy Efficiency Project), Board Member
  • Joseph Jolley (Mandalay Bay), Board Member

The National Green Chamber of Commerce

Las Vegas Green Chamber of CommerceThe Las Vegas chapter is part of the national Green Chamber of Commerce based in the San Francisco Bay area. It is a non-profit 501(c)6 and is expanding in the United States by adding new chapters. The national chapter partners include Shade Fund, Sustainable Silicon Valley, Business Alliance for a Green Economy, and Green America.

There are many ways businesses can be more eco-friendly:

  • Green printing
  • Car-pooling
  • Recycling
  • Electronic statements, quotes, and invoices
  • Shop online for office products
  • Use non-toxic cleaning products
  • Re-fill ink cartridges
  • Use recycled paper products

The Las Vegas Green Chamber of Commerce actively strives to help reduce dependence on fossil fuels to help reverse global warming. They educate the general public and businesses about what can be done to help support a healthier global environment.

Benefits of being a Member

Being a member has its advantages. Becoming a member of the Green Chamber gives you exposure on their website and increases the public’s awareness of your dedication to the environment. Members receive discounted admission to events. Once you are a member, you will be connected to all the chapters in the United States.
